Snow Bros. (スノーブラザーズ) is a 1990 arcade game which was ported to the Sega Mega Drive in 1993. The game follows two snowmen named Nick and Tom, who must defeat all the on-screen enemies by creating giant snowballs. It is built similarly to Bubble Bobble.

The Mega Drive version adds cutscenes to the game, as well as some more background music and several additional levels. This version was only released in Japan and Korea.
